Hugs are helpful, especially when women step out into a mostly male political world. Emotional support, at critical moments, enables women to stay in the race.
Madeleine M. Kunin

Hugs provide emotional support that is particularly beneficial for women in challenging environments.

This quote highlights the importance of emotional support, particularly through physical gestures like hugs, for women navigating male-dominated sectors such as politics. It underlines how this support can empower women to remain resilient and committed in their pursuits despite the obstacles they may face.
